PC's note:
"I was stealing electricity from the stage for this run, and
during the opener (Ice Cream Factory), the power went out
when a generator failed, which caused my microphones to die
instantly.  I immediately paused my DAP-1 and computer (the
internal batteries kicked-in & they never lost power), and
then powered down all of the other gear (microphone power
supply, Mini-Me) and waited for power to come back on.  Once
it came back on, I immediately powered up my microphones and
waited for the tubes to warm-up. As soon as I saw the levels
regain their presence, I un-paused the DAT & laptop and began
rolling once again.  The gap that is on the tape is unedited,
and is exactly the way that it worked out.  The only thing
that was not recorded was Rodney's solo, as he was the only
one able to keep playing w/o power."
